CONFIG_ARM_ENTRY_VENEERS_LIB_NAME

Entry Veneers symbol file

Type: string

Help

Library file to find the symbol table for the entry veneers.
The library will typically come from building the Secure
Firmware that contains secure entry functions, and allows
the Non-Secure Firmware to call into the Secure Firmware.

Direct dependencies

(ARM_FIRMWARE_HAS_SECURE_ENTRY_FUNCS || ARM_FIRMWARE_USES_SECURE_ENTRY_FUNCS) && (ARM_SECURE_FIRMWARE || ARM_NONSECURE_FIRMWARE) && ARM_TRUSTZONE_M && CPU_CORTEX_M && ARM

(Includes any dependencies from ifs and menus.)

Default

  • “libentryveneers.a”
